The thesis I have chosen to write about on a commonly held misconception is that cracking your knuckles will give you arthritis. I feel that everyone has, at some point in their lives heard the phrase “cracking your joints will give you arthritis”, even now that this misconception has been proven false many people still say this or believe it.
Joint cracking can arise from the negative pressure pulling nitrogen gas into the joint, the sound can also arise from tendons snapping over tissues due to minor adjustments in their gliding paths. Both actions are completely harmless to any joint in the human body and will not cause damage especially in the form of arthritis.
There are two major types of arthritis; osteoarthritis and rheumatoid arthritis,

You are much more at risk for contracting arthritis if a parent or sibling also has it, if you are elderly, if you are a woman you are more at risk of contracting rheumatoid arthritis whereas if you are a man you are more at risk of contracting gout, you are also more likely to contract arthritis if you are obese as there is extra pressure on your joints. As you can see the cracking of joints is not a factor of contracting arthritis.
Consider the findings of researcher, Donald Unger, as a teen his mother warned him that cracking his knuckles would give him arthritis. So, to prove her wrong he cracked all the knuckles on one hand only for 60 years and then compared both to look for traces of arthritis. As expected there were no traces, for his work he won the IG Noble Prize in Medicine. The IG Noble Prize is very like the Nobel Prize award except that it allows it winners to show their inventions and their findings.
It has also been thought that cracking your joints is a good thing as the act of cracking stretches the joints and stimulates the nerve endings there causing pleasure.     Scientists are trying to figure out what’s in fracking fluids that contains hazardous compounds. Fracking involves injecting water with a mix of chemical additives into rock formations deep underground to promote the release of oil and gas. Throughout the United States, the fracking fluid has led to a natural gas boom, which caused a lot of oppositions and troubling reports of well water that was contaminated. Scientists that are working to figure out what the hazardous compounds are concluded that there are about 8 substances that had raised a red flag, and were identified as being particularly toxic to mammals.     The Environmental Protection Agency defines frackings as “A well stimulation process used to maximize the extraction of underground resources; including oil, natural gas, geothermal energy, and even water”(Environmental Protection Agency). This process, employed to release natural gas involves drilling deep into the ground and shooting a high pressure water solution into rock formations in order to release the gas inside. Although the history of fracking can be traced back to the 1940’s, it wasn’t until 2003 that was incorporated commercially on a massive scale not only in the United States, but also across the world. This turning point in scale caused immediate backlash from environmentalists across the country.     Arthritis is inflammation in joints, and can affect one or many joints. This is common disease is not limited to just adults 65 and over but can occur in teens or children. In arthritis the joint is inflamed and this causes joint pain and limit of movement in the joint. There are around 100 types of arthritis, but two common forms are osteoarthritis and rheumatoid arthritis.
